#2. Rey Mysterio did wonders in Royal Rumble 2006
Not only did Rey Mysterio win the Royal Rumble match, but he also did it after entering at number 2.
WWE tends to slightly overuse the David versus Goliath trope. However, Goliath generally comes out on top in Vince McMahon's promotion. Rey Mysterio is one of those 'Davids', who managed to overcome various giants. In the process, he also won the 2006 edition of the Rumble.

He began the match against Triple H and remained in the ring for 62 minutes and 12 seconds. This meant that he broke the record for longest time spent in the match previously held by Chris Benoit.
Mysterio threw superstars such as Rob Van Dam, Triple H and Randy Orton over the top rope in order to triumph. He would go on to headline WrestleMania, alongside Kurt Angle and Randy Orton, even winning the World Heavyweight Championship.
#1. Edge outlasted everyone else in 2021
Edge entered the 2021 Royal Rumble at number 1, facing off against former tag team partner Randy Orton. Both men would go on to survive as the final two competitors in the match.
Though Edge and Orton survived for 58 minutes and 30 seconds, Edge had only 3 eliminations and Orton had none. Edge eliminated Braun Strowman (with the help of Rollins and Christian), Seth Rollins and finally The Apex Predator himself to challenge Roman Reigns at WrestleMania.
However, this resulted in the Rated-R Superstar creating an unfortunate record. He is the only two-time Royal Rumble winner to fail to capture the title in both of his WrestleMania matches.
